Changing weather condition,region height and meteorological parameters of atmosphere determines the feasibility of proposed research,technical and commercial applications of THz electromagnetic wave transmission.According to International Telecommunication Union Radio communication Sector(ITU-R)recommendation P.676-9,the paper programmed,simulated and calculated THz band atmospheric gases attenuation under different water-vapour density(0,5,7.5,15g/m3),temperature(-20,15.40℃),barometric pressure(80,101.3,110kPa),respectively.Then,based on the solid electronics THz band T/R modules,series 330GHz wave propagation attenuation experiment are carried out under certain atmosphere environment.Series experimental results of IF power show good agreement with the calculation results,the power discrepancy less than 1.5dB.
